wtf is this shit
This commit is contained in:
parent
1353a5b4ee
commit
3f1e5eb2ec
@ -1,6 +1,7 @@
|
|||||||
image: python:3.11
|
image: python:3.10
|
||||||
|
|
||||||
variables:
|
variables:
|
||||||
|
WINDOWS_PYTHON_PACKAGE_NAME: "python310"
|
||||||
PIP_CACHE_DIR: "$CI_PROJECT_DIR/.cache/pip"
|
PIP_CACHE_DIR: "$CI_PROJECT_DIR/.cache/pip"
|
||||||
PIPENV_VENV_IN_PROJECT: 1
|
PIPENV_VENV_IN_PROJECT: 1
|
||||||
UPDATE_WINDOWS_DEPS:
|
UPDATE_WINDOWS_DEPS:
|
||||||
@ -24,8 +25,6 @@ prepare:
|
|||||||
before_script:
|
before_script:
|
||||||
- pip install setuptools_scm>=6.2
|
- pip install setuptools_scm>=6.2
|
||||||
script:
|
script:
|
||||||
- PYTHON_VERSION=$(python --version | cut -d " " -f2)
|
|
||||||
- echo "PYTHON_VERSION=${PYTHON_VERSION}" | tee -a build.env
|
|
||||||
- VERSION=$(python -m setuptools_scm)
|
- VERSION=$(python -m setuptools_scm)
|
||||||
- echo "VERSION=${VERSION}" | tee -a build.env
|
- echo "VERSION=${VERSION}" | tee -a build.env
|
||||||
- echo "LINUX_AMD64_BINARY=fime_linux_amd64_${VERSION}" | tee -a build.env
|
- echo "LINUX_AMD64_BINARY=fime_linux_amd64_${VERSION}" | tee -a build.env
|
||||||
@ -56,7 +55,7 @@ update_windows_deps:
|
|||||||
- prepare
|
- prepare
|
||||||
before_script:
|
before_script:
|
||||||
- Import-Module "$env:ChocolateyInstall\helpers\chocolateyProfile.psm1"
|
- Import-Module "$env:ChocolateyInstall\helpers\chocolateyProfile.psm1"
|
||||||
- choco install python --version=$PYTHON_VERSION -y --no-progress
|
- choco install $WINDOWS_PYTHON_PACKAGE_NAME -y --no-progress
|
||||||
- refreshenv
|
- refreshenv
|
||||||
- python --version
|
- python --version
|
||||||
- pip install pipenv
|
- pip install pipenv
|
||||||
@ -118,7 +117,7 @@ package_windows:
|
|||||||
- if: $CI_COMMIT_TAG
|
- if: $CI_COMMIT_TAG
|
||||||
before_script:
|
before_script:
|
||||||
- Import-Module "$env:ChocolateyInstall\helpers\chocolateyProfile.psm1"
|
- Import-Module "$env:ChocolateyInstall\helpers\chocolateyProfile.psm1"
|
||||||
- choco install python --version=$PYTHON_VERSION -y --no-progress
|
- choco install $WINDOWS_PYTHON_PACKAGE_NAME -y --no-progress
|
||||||
- refreshenv
|
- refreshenv
|
||||||
- python --version
|
- python --version
|
||||||
- pip install pipenv
|
- pip install pipenv
|
||||||
|
Loading…
Reference in New Issue
Block a user